Section IV: Procedure

IV.1) Description
IV.1.1) Type of procedure
Negotiated procedure without publication of a contract notice
  • The works, supplies or services can be provided only by a particular economic operator for the following reason:
    • absence of competition for technical reasons
Explanation:

DALO intends to enter into a framework agreement regarding sustainment of HF Radio Communication System equipment consisting of Thales UK Ltd.’s Series 600 HF Transmitter and Receiver equipment.

The agreement shall cover the delivery of spare parts, documentation and sustainment services such as repair and support-services related to the equipment in question.

Thales UK Ltd. holds the exclusive rights and the full documentation of the equipment in question. Furthermore, only Thales UK Ltd. holds the exclusive rights and has the specific and sufficient know-how regarding the equipment necessary to deliver spare parts to the equipment without compromising the need for a complete fully interoperability in order to secure the complete functioning of the equipment.

Finally, only Thales UK Ltd. has the sufficient level of documentation and specific know-how regarding the equipment and spare parts to deliver the relevant sustainment services.

Hence, due to the nature of the acquisition in question and the circumstances related hereto, it is DALO assessment that, for technical reasons and reasons connected with the protection of exclusive rights, the framework agreement can only be awarded to Thales UK Ltd. and hence, the DALO intents to award the agreement to Thales UK Ltd. in accordance with article 28(1)(e) of Directive 2009/81/EC.

NOTE: That both "absence of competition for technical reasons" and "protection of exclusive rights, including intellectual property rights" are relevant as reasons for abovementioned justification.
